Author Jack Polo has created an intriguing team of private investigators in Death in Paraiso. Jamal Wade and Matt Singer are comfortable with each other, and the reader soon becomes comfortable with them as they uncover deep pockets of corruption in the beautiful coast town of Paraiso. Is the big crook the mayor? The police chief? A long-missing Mexican contractor? Wade and Singer follow all leads, even some you would never have guessed.
I enjoyed the novel and read it straight through. Yes, I am ready for more!
